Output 62bd163162ab08d324aea136210685d49787039b70ba296a06efc39739750913:8

value
5163153489
script pubkey
OP_0 OP_PUSHBYTES_32 fa9e591f4d7e9efc4d4d13eea91cf00e158da427d4ba52fcf5c94e713f5a781c
address
bc1ql209j86d0600cn2dz0h2j88spc2cmfp86ja99l84e988z0660qwqld52w9
transaction
62bd163162ab08d324aea136210685d49787039b70ba296a06efc39739750913
spent
true